Faulty switches and dimmers are common issues faced by electricians. Proper diagnosis is essential to ensure safety and functionality. This guide provides a step-by-step approach to diagnosing these problems effectively.
Understanding Switches and Dimmers
Switches control the flow of electricity to lights, while dimmers allow for adjustable lighting levels. Both devices are integral to modern electrical systems, but they can develop faults over time due to wear, damage, or poor installation.
Common Symptoms of Faulty Switches and Dimmers
- Lights flickering or not turning on
- Dimmer switches that do not adjust brightness
- Intermittent operation
- Burning smells or sparks
- Switch or dimmer feels warm to touch
Tools Needed for Diagnosis
Before starting, gather essential tools:
- Multimeter
- Screwdriver
- Voltage tester
- Wire strippers
Step-by-Step Diagnosis Process
1. Safety First
Turn off the power at the circuit breaker before inspecting or working on switches or dimmers. Use a voltage tester to confirm the circuit is de-energized.
2. Visual Inspection
Check for signs of damage, burn marks, loose wires, or corrosion. Ensure that the switch or dimmer is properly mounted and that wires are securely connected.
3. Testing the Switch or Dimmer
Restore power and use a multimeter to test for continuity. For switches, verify that the circuit opens and closes properly. For dimmers, check if the device responds to adjustments.
4. Checking the Wiring
Ensure wiring matches the manufacturer’s wiring diagram. Look for loose, broken, or disconnected wires. Replace any damaged wiring as needed.
When to Replace
If the switch or dimmer shows signs of physical damage, fails continuity tests, or does not respond correctly during testing, replacement is recommended. Always use compatible devices and follow local electrical codes.
